powinny
"Powinny" means "should" or "ought to" (used for plural subjects).
The word 'powinny' is used here to express a recommendation or requirement for plural noun 'dzieci' (children).
Dzieci powinny jeść zdrowe jedzenie.
Children should eat healthy food.
Here, 'powinnyśmy' is used in a question form, specifically addressing a group of speakers, all female, as 'we' intending necessity or advice.
Czy powinnyśmy zacząć od początku?
Should we start over?
